Functions

Function selection

The type of output signal is selected with the func-

tion selection switch  . A total number of 4 diffe-

rent waveforms (sine, square, triangle and pulse) 

are available. The functions are marked with the 

corresponding symbols. If the ON-pushbutton   

is activated a DC voltage level is supplied by the 

HM8030-6 (all function LEDs   off) or superim-

posed on the output signal, except in pulse mode.

The max. offset voltage is ±5 V with open outputs 

and is continuously adjustable with the OFFSET 

control  .

In pulse mode no offset voltage is available. With 

control   pulse width is continuously adjustable 

from 10% to 90%. In postition OFF of pushbutton 

 a fixed pulse width of 50% is delivered.

Frequency adjustment

Coarse adjustment is performed with the range 

keys  . The desired frequency is selected by 

turning the FREQUENCy control  . The selected 

frequency appears on the 5-digit display  .  

Output amplitude and signal connection

Adaptation in decade steps to the desired am-

plitude range is performed by the use of two 

attenuators with –20 dB each, which are activated 

by pushbuttons  .

Including the continuously adjustable AMPLI-

TUDE control  , the maximum attenuation 

amounts to –60dB.  With the maximum amplitude 

of 10V

pp

, the minimum signal voltage to be sup-

plied is about 10mV. These values are obtained 

when the generator output is terminated into 

50 Ω. In the open-circuit condition, the available 

signal amplitude is twice as high. Therefore the 

maximum output voltage of the output socket 

is  specified  with  20V

pp

. If exact square-shaped 

signals are required, care should be taken that 

only  50 Ω  coaxial  cables  (e.g.  HZ34)  are  used. 

Furthermore, this cable must be terminated into a 

50 Ω through-termination (e.g. HZ22). If these pre

-

cautions are not observed, overshoot may occur, 

especially when high frequencies are selected. 

If test circuits having a 50 Ω input impedance are 

connected, this termination is not required.  In high 

signal voltage ranges, it should be noted that the 

terminating resistor used must be specified for 

the power dissipated.

The output terminal of the HM8030-6 is short 

circuit proof. However, if an external DC-voltage 

exceeding ±45 V is applied to the output, the 

output  stage  is  likely  to  be  destructed.  It  can 

withstand DC-voltage up to ±45 V for a time of 

max. 30 seconds.

If the output of the HM8030-6 unit comes into 

contact with components of the circuit under 

test, which are carrying DC voltage, an isola-

tion capacitor of appropriate dielectric strength 

should be connected in series with the output of 

the generator. The capacitance of this isolating 

capacitor should be selected in that way that the 

frequency response of the output signal is not 

affected over the whole frequency range of the  

HM 8030-6 unit.

Trigger output

In the sine, square and triangle modes, the trigger 

output   supplies a square signal in synchronism 

with the output signal. An offset voltage adjusted at 

the 50 Ω output has no influence upon the trigger 

signal. The trigger output is short-circuit-proof 

and can drive several TTL inputs. If the trigger 

output is terminated into 50 Ω, the trigger level 

will fall below TTL specifications. Therefore short 

or low-capacity cables without a 50 Ω termination 

are to be used.
